Nutritionally tofu and tempeh are very similar. While both would make an excellent addition to your next meal, there are slight differences to consider. Generally, tempeh is higher in protein than tofu. This is primarily due to the additional legumes, grains, seeds and nuts used to make tempeh.

WebNov 18, 2024 · Tempeh is soybeans that have been fermented with Rhizopus oligosporus into a block. It is high in protein and a great plant-based meat alternative. High protein foods help you stay full on a vegan diet. Traditional tempeh contains only soybeans. There are many varieties today that include flaxseed, whole grains, and even chickpeas.
